An Indo-Portuguese ivory figure of St Paul, late 18th/early 19th century
the barefoot figure holding a Bible in his left hand and a sword in his right, his flowing robes outlined with a gilt border and stylised foliate and dot motifs, standing on an oval base, with later turned oval wooden base, 18cm including base
